1. Brush Your Teeth Twice a Day

Brushing your teeth at least twice daily is fundamental to maintaining good oral hygiene. By brushing in the morning and before bedtime, you help remove the buildup of plaque, bacteria, and food particles that accumulate throughout the day.

Plaque is a sticky film of bacteria that forms on your teeth and can lead to cavities and gum disease if not properly removed. When brushing, use a soft-bristled toothbrush and fluoride toothpaste. Fluoride is a mineral that strengthens tooth enamel and makes it more resistant to decay.

2. Floss Daily

Flossing is an often overlooked but essential daily dental care routine. While brushing cleans the surfaces of your teeth, flossing helps clean the spaces between your teeth and below the gum line. These are areas where a toothbrush cannot reach effectively.

When you floss, it removes plaque, food particles, and debris that may lead to gum inflammation and cavities.

3. Use Mouthwash

Incorporating mouthwash into your daily routine can offer additional benefits for your oral health. Mouthwash helps reduce the number of bacteria in your mouth and can freshen your breath.

Look for an alcohol-free mouthwash that contains fluoride. Alcohol-free formulas are gentler on your mouth’s soft tissues, reducing the risk of dryness and irritation.

4. Limit Sugary and Acidic Foods

The foods you consume have a significant impact on your oral health. Sugary foods and beverages and acidic foods can contribute to tooth decay and enamel erosion. When you consume sugary substances, bacteria in your mouth feed on the sugars, producing acids that attack your tooth enamel.

Over time, this can weaken the enamel and lead to cavities. Similarly, acidic foods and drinks can directly erode the enamel, making it more vulnerable to decay. If you indulge in these foods, consider rinsing your mouth with water afterward to help neutralize the acids and wash away leftover sugars.

5. Schedule Regular Dental Check-Ups

Regular visits to the dentist are vital for maintaining optimal oral health. Dental check-ups and cleanings should be scheduled every six months or as your dentist recommends. During these visits, your dentist will thoroughly examine your teeth and gums, looking for any signs of dental issues.

Early detection of dental problems allows for timely intervention, preventing more extensive and costly treatments in the future.
